Understanding Brand Identity
Brand identity is the collection of all elements that a company creates to portray the right image to its consumer. It encompasses everything from the logo, typography, color palette, and visual style to the tone of voice and messaging. A well-developed brand identity is crucial for business success as it helps to differentiate a company from its competitors and fosters customer loyalty.

Key Components of Brand Identity
- Logo: The logo is often the first thing people associate with a brand. A well-designed logo is simple, memorable, and aligns with the brand's values.
- Typography: Fonts play a crucial role in conveying the brand's tone and personality. Consistent typography usage helps in creating a cohesive brand image.
- Color Palette: Colors can evoke specific emotions and associations. Choosing the right color palette is essential for establishing brand recognition.
- Visual Style: This includes imagery, graphics, and overall design style that reflects the brand's essence.
- Tone of Voice: The way a brand communicates with its audience through text and speech. It should reflect the brand's personality and values.
Developing Your Brand Identity
To develop a strong brand identity, start by understanding your brand's core values, mission, and target audience. Conduct a brand audit to assess your current brand assets and identify areas for improvement. Consider the following steps:
- Research Your Audience: Understand who they are, their preferences, and how they perceive your brand.
- Define Your Brand's Mission: Clearly articulate what your brand stands for and what you aim to achieve.
- Create Visual Assets: Work with designers to develop a logo, typography, and color palette that align with your brand's values.
- Establish Brand Guidelines: Document how your brand should be represented across various channels and ensure consistency.
Maintaining Brand Identity
Consistency is key to maintaining a strong brand identity. Ensure that all brand communications, whether they are digital or physical, adhere to your brand guidelines. Regularly review and update your brand identity to reflect any changes in your business strategy or market trends.
Additionally, engage with your audience to gather feedback and insights. This will help you understand how your brand is perceived and identify opportunities for improvement.
